| """
|
| 标签数据预处理脚本
|
| 将TIF格式的标签转换为PNG格式的二值mask
|
| """
|
| import os
|
| import numpy as np
|
| from PIL import Image
|
| import rasterio
|
| from pathlib import Path
|
| import shutil
|
|
|
| def convert_tif_label_to_png_mask(tif_path, output_path, threshold=1):
|
| """将TIF标签转换为PNG二值mask"""
|
| try:
|
| with rasterio.open(tif_path) as src:
|
|
|
| label_data = src.read(1)
|
|
|
|
|
| mask = np.zeros_like(label_data, dtype=np.uint8)
|
| mask[label_data >= threshold] = 255
|
|
|
|
|
| mask_img = Image.fromarray(mask, mode='L')
|
| mask_img.save(output_path)
|
|
|
| print(f"转换: {tif_path} -> {output_path}")
|
| print(f" 原始数据范围: {label_data.min()} - {label_data.max()}")
|
| print(f" Mask唯一值: {np.unique(mask)}")
|
| return True
|
|
|
| except Exception as e:
|
| print(f"转换失败 {tif_path}: {str(e)}")
|
| return False
